What She Revealed | The  Daily DishIn a jaw-dropping moment that has reality TV fans buzzing, Vanderpump Rules star Brittany Cartwright publicly slammed her estranged husband Jax Taylor on Watch What Happens Live with Andy Cohen. During her late-April appearance, Brittany didn’t hold back—she rated Jax a mere 2 or 3 out of 10 when asked about his bedroom performance, adding bluntly that he "has no stamina."

The comment sent shockwaves through social media, sparking intense debate. While some fans applauded Brittany for her honesty, others criticized her for airing intimate details—especially as the pair continue to co-parent their son Cruz, who is currently receiving treatment for autism.

But just when it seemed like Brittany’s bombshell would be the end of it, things took another dramatic turn. Paige Woolen, the woman believed to be Jax’s new flame, made what many interpreted as a fiery and public clapback. Though she hasn’t addressed Brittany’s remarks directly, Paige drew headlines for jokingly announcing “I’m pregnant!” while holding an alcoholic drink at a public birthday party—an event Jax also attended.

The party took place at Jax’s Studio City bar for Jeremy Madix (Ariana Madix’s brother), and Paige’s cheeky announcement—delivered loudly, and possibly sarcastically—was seen by many as a subtle dig at Brittany’s bedroom critique. Known for her spicy social media presence and her Instagram page @dudesinthedm (where she calls out shady men), Paige is no stranger to controversy—and this move only fueled speculation.

Jax, for his part, denied being in a relationship with Paige, writing on X (formerly Twitter), “I’m not dating anyone and I wish people knew the full story. It’s not what it seems.” Despite his denials, the two have been seen together on multiple occasions—grabbing lunch and attending events—raising eyebrows about the nature of their relationship.

Meanwhile, Brittany is sticking to her statements. On her podcast When Reality Hits, she elaborated on the breakdown of their marriage, claiming that they had only been intimate “twice in a year” before separating. She also expressed frustration over Jax’s repeated absence from key moments in their son’s life.

While much of the drama revolves around Jax’s alleged shortcomings in the bedroom, what matters most to fans is whether he and Brittany can move past their personal issues to co-parent Cruz in a healthy way.
